Verse of the Day
Proverbs 18:2 NIV
A fool finds no pleasure in understanding but delights in airing his own opinions.
Translations of Today's Verse
King James Version
A fool hath no delight in understanding, but that his heart may discover itself.English Standard Version
A fool takes no pleasure in understanding, but only in expressing his opinion.The Message
Fools care nothing for thoughtful discourse; all they do is run off at the mouth.New King James Version
A fool has no delight in understanding, But in expressing his own heart.New Living Translation
Fools have no interest in understanding; they only want to air their own opinions.Proverbs 18:2 In-Context

Commentary on Today's Verse
Commentary on Proverbs 18:2
(Read Proverbs 18:2)
Those make nothing to purpose, of learning or religion, whose only design is to have something to make a show with.
